注册 登录
编程论坛 C++教室

求将《锄禾》用程序输出来

yanpiaoling 发布于 2011-04-15 12:41, 880 次点击
题为:
对主函数不进行修改,输出下列诗句。
锄禾日当午,
汗滴禾下土。
谁知盘中餐,
粒粒皆辛苦。
原来的程序为:
#include <iostream.h>
void main(void)
{   
cout<<"汗滴禾下土。"<<endl;  
}

那位好心人帮帮忙,谢了先!
11 回复
#2
qq10235692232011-04-15 13:51
程序代码:
#include <iostream.h>
void main(void)
{  
cout<<"汗滴禾下土。\n汗滴禾下土。\n谁知盘中餐,\n粒粒皆辛苦。"<<endl;
}

不修改怎么行!
#3
一切皆安2011-04-15 15:00
#4
诸葛修勤2011-04-15 15:29
程序代码:
#include <iostream.h>

void * show()
{
    cout << "锄禾日当午," << endl
         << "汗滴禾下土。" << endl
         << "谁知盘中餐," << endl
         << "粒粒皆辛苦。" << endl;

    return NULL;
}

void *f = show();


#if s
void main(void)
{  
    cout<<"汗滴禾下土。"<<endl;
}
#else
int main(void)
{
    return 0;
}
#endif
#5
诸葛修勤2011-04-15 15:34
程序代码:
#include <iostream.h>

#define cout  cout << "锄禾日当午,\n"
#define endl  endl << "谁知盘中餐," << endl \
                    << "粒粒皆辛苦。" << endl

void main(void)
{  
    cout<<"汗滴禾下土。"<<endl;
}
#6
诸葛修勤2011-04-15 15:39
回复 楼主 yanpiaoling
做这个有什么用?  能提高什么?

这是在玩编译器   不好玩滴

多干点别的有意思的东西
#7
lintaoyn2011-04-15 15:49
程序代码:
//第一种
#include <iostream.h>
class A
{
public:
    A(){cout << "锄禾日当午,\n";}
    ~A(){cout << "谁知盘中餐,\n粒粒皆辛苦。\n";}
};
A a;
void main(void)
{  
cout<<"汗滴禾下土。"<<endl;
}
//第二种
#include <iostream.h>
class A
{
public:
    A(){cout << "锄禾日当午,\n";}
    ~A(){cout << "谁知盘中餐,\n粒粒皆辛苦。\n";}
    static A a;
};
A A::a;
void main(void)
{  
cout<<"汗滴禾下土。"<<endl;
}
#8
Lyone2011-04-15 15:53
这是中国新出的C++奥利匹克题目么?
#9
bccn2502011-04-15 18:32
学习学习

7楼的方法好!我顶


[ 本帖最后由 bccn250 于 2011-4-15 18:36 编辑 ]
#10
pangding2011-04-15 22:26
额,这题目还真是有意思。

lintaoyn 以前的头像就是这样吗?
#11
yanpiaoling2011-04-15 22:59
谢谢了
#12
守墨2011-04-16 09:50
不懂就问吗,在于交流,不是问题本身
1